Job Description

Kentucky State University is hiring a full-time Extension Assistant for Environmental Education in Frankfort, KY. This role involves supporting educational programs on environmental education and natural resource conservation, leading outdoor activities, and interacting with visitors. Candidates should have a degree in a related field and experience in environmental education. The job requires physical activity and may involve non-traditional hours.

JOB SUMMARY:

Under general direction of the Manager of the Environmental Education and Research Center (EERC), this position conducts and supports the implementation of educational programs in areas of environmental education and natural resource conservation.

Conducting and supporting the implementation of educational programs in areas of environmental education and natural resource conservation.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
• Assists in providing environmental education programming and activities at the EERC for visitors of all ages, abilities, and backgrounds.
• Leads outdoor recreation activities, hikes, and other activities that demonstrate safe and appropriate learning in a natural environment.
• Assists with the education of and curriculum development for student groups and ensures quality supervision during programs, maintaining effective communication with chaperones at all times.
• Works alongside specialists and agents within the Kentucky Cooperative Extension System to implement environmental education programming at the EERC and area schools.
• Interacts spontaneously with visitors and center staff to ensure an inviting atmosphere for the facility, answering visitor questions and providing assistance to guests when needed.

QUALIFICATIONS:
• Bachelor of Science degree in biology, ecology, environmental science, or a related discipline.
• One to three years of experience working in the field of environmental education, science communication, education, or related disciplines.

WORKING CONDITIONS:
• Work involves some exposure to unusual elements, such as extreme temperatures, dirt, dust, fumes, smoke, unpleasant odors, and/or loud noises.
• Maintenance/work in outdoor recreation areas involves extended physical exertion.
• Requires handling of objects up to 50 pounds. Standing, walking, hiking required.
• Working non-traditional hours on occasion, including evening and weekend hours.
• Some travel required.
• Very limited exposure to physical risk.
